Self-sampling and self-testing for HIV at a commercial and community-based test provider in the Netherlands: user preferences and usability

Abstract HIV self-sampling and -testing (HIVSS/ST) reduces testing barriers and potentially reaches populations who may not test otherwise.In the Netherlands, at-home HIV tests became commercially available around 2016, but data on user experiences are limited.This study aimed to explore characteristics of users and their experiences with HIVSS/ST.
